N2 - A band is a semigroup whose elements are idempotents. The paper is motivated by some open problems concerning linear representations of bands. A counter example to a conjecture stated in [1] is given. On the other hand, it is proved that there exist linear bands with two components such that the associated commutative K-algebra constructed in [1] cannot be embedded into any Noetherian ring, even in the case where this algebra is reduced. © 2009 Departament de Matemàtiques Universitat Autònoma de Barcelona.
